Description

NGC 55, also occasionally referred to as The Whale Galaxy, is a Magellanic type barred spiral galaxy located about 7 million light-years away in the constellation Sculptor. Along with its neighbor NGC 300, it is one of the closest galaxies to the Local Group, probably lying between the Milky Way and the Sculptor Group.

This image was captured during the 10th Brazilian Meeting of Astrophotography.

Technical data

4 lights 300s, ISO 800, total integration time: 20 min. Camera Temperature 05 - 07 ºC. No darks, bias or flats applied.
